Steven Callahan is the author of Adrift, Seventy-Six Days Lost at Sea, which chronicles his life-raft drift across half the Atlantic in 1982, became an NYT Bestseller and has been translated into 15 languages.He also wrote Capsized for survivor Jim Nalepka who spent four months with four other men on an overturned, half-flooded boat.
